I found big improvements with the firmware update with the Juno lights, and the lights legitimately did not seem to need to be factory reset. However, I still had/have instances where they go “offline” in ZHA and Z2MQTT, and needed to be power cycled, making them unreliable long term for smart bulb mode and zigbee binding.
I’m currently -slowly- replacing all the Juno’s in the house with a Gledopto ~4" RGB CCT tunable wafer downlight. CRI claims to be just as high, they don’t have the same options for a baffled regressed version, so I don’t love the look of them as much, but they seem to be rock solid at this point.
